PROJECT DESCRIPTION: Figure 8 Island is a barrier island located in northern New Hanover County between Rich Inlet to the north and Mason Inlet to the south. The island is predominantly north -south facing and is approximately 4.5 miles in length. It is bordered Banks Channel to the west and the Atlantic Ocean to the east. Lea/Hutaff Island is located to the north of Rich Inlet and Wrightsville Beach is located to the south of Mason Inlet. The island is accessed from US Highway 17 via a single bridge at the end of Edgewater Club Road (which is located off of Porters Neck Road). Access to the island is gated and accessible only to property owners and authorized visitors. As such, site visits to the island should be arranged with the applicant in advance to ensure timely access. The project site extends from the southern end of S. Beach Road to Bridge Road. The long-term erosion rate for the project area ranges from 0'-2'/year. The 100 -year storm recession line for the island was predicted to be 265'. The southernmost portion of the project is located within an Inlet Hazard Area. In 2004, Permit No. 139-04 was issued to Figure 8 Island HOA for the dredging of Banks Channel and associated beach nourishment along 10,000 linear feet of shoreline (USAGE AID No. 200400895 and DWR Project No. 040987). The original channel was authorized at 125' in width and to be dredged to a depth of 7' with a 2' overdredge allowance relative to Mean Low Water (MLW). In 2006, a major modification was issued on March 16 to expand approximately 5,750 linear feet of channel to 200' in width. According to the applicant, it is believed that an expansion of the southern —2,400 linear feet of the channel was not authorized at the time due to concerns regarding potential impacts resulting from the Mason Inlet relocation project, although a wider 300' long "turning basin" at the southern terminus of the maintained channel was permitted to allow safe navigation for boaters and skiers. Minor modifications to the permit were also issued in 2010 and 2012 to allow for maintenance dredging of the channel with associated beach nourishment. Beach nourishment for the project appears to have been originally authorized at an elevation of +9.5' Mean Sea Level (MSL) with a maximum elevation of +10' MSL. Beach nourishment on the island has also occurred through New Hanover County's maintenance of Mason Inlet (State Permit No. 151-01) and two projects often occur sequentially to reduce mobilization costs. The native beach was originally characterized with data collected for the initial permit application in 2004. Fines were calculated at less than 1%, with no granular and gravel material and a median grain size ranging from 0.23-0.35 mm. Calcium carbonate and clast counts of material greater than 3" in size do not appear to have been calculated. The waters of Banks Channel fall within the Cape Fear River Basin, as classified by the NC Division of Water Resources (DWR). The waters are classified as SA-ORW by the DWR. The NC Division of Marine Fisheries has designated the area north of the project boundary in Banks Channel as a Primary Nursery Area (PNA), but the proposed dredging appears to be located outside of the PNA. The waters of Banks Channel are OPEN to the harvesting of shellfish. PROPOSED PROJECT: The applicant is proposing a maintenance dredging and a widening of Banks Channel along with associated beach nourishment. A scoping meeting was held for the project on April 5, 2019. State of North Carolina I Environmental Quality I Coastal Management Wilmington Office 1 127 Cardinal Drive Extension I Wilmington, North Carolina 28405 910 796 7215 Figure 8 Beach HOA -Major Modification No. 139-04 Page 3 The applicant proposes to dredge 9,494 linear feet of Banks Channel, and to expand the remaining 2,370' length of the channel at the southern end of the project to measure 200'in width along with an additional taper out to the 300' width turning basin at the southernmost end of the project (see Sheet 3 of 15). The northernmost —750' of channel extends beyond the limits of the previous channel expansion, and would still be dredged to the originally authorized 125' width; although it appears there is also a slight expansion in channel width from Station 85+00 to 88+00 (see Sheet 6 of 15). Dredging would be performed via a 16"-18" cutterhead pipeline dredge to a depth of -9' MLW (-7' MLW with a 2' overdredge allowance), as indicated in the application. It is anticipated that the project would occur in coordination with the County's next Mason Inlet maintenance project. The pipeline route would extend around the inlet area. The applicant states that no impacts to coastal wetlands are anticipated as a result of the proposed project as a 3:1 design slope has been included in the design parameters. The project's placement area would remain within the confines of the previously authorized beach nourishment boundaries, extending from the southern end of S. Beach Road a distance of approximately 10,000 linear feet to the north, and terminating at a point east of Bridge Road. A dune of varying width, measuring up to approximately 42' at its widest point as indicated on plans, is proposed at a height of +12' NAVD88 and with a 5:1 slope. The berm would then be constructed at an elevation of +5' NAVD 88 (ranging from approximately 40'-150' in width), with a 25:1 slope extending out to a depth of -10' NAVD88. The applicant's narrative states that fill volume for the project would not exceed 50 cubic yards per linear foot. As proposed, this project would excavate approximately 193,300 cubic yards of sand. It is currently estimated that 3,239,318 square feet would be filled below MHW (74.4 acres) and approximately 1,760,682 square feet of beach fill material would be placed above the MHW line (40.4 acres). Vibracores samples taken in and immediately adjacent to the expanded channel area (and within the proposed dredge depth) contained less than 1% each of gravel, granular & fines material and 1%-2.1% calcium carbonate. Dune planting is also proposed in association with this project. The application states planting would likely consist of Sea Oats (Uniola paniculata) and include use of a tractor, mechanical planter and water truck. It is stated that the plantings are proposed the entire length of the nourishment project and would potentially be cover an area of up to 649,000 square feet. Due to the recent ongoing discussion about developing dune planting protocols, minimal information has been provided at this time, but the applicant would like it to be included in the project description and additional information can be obtained prior to permitting. 10. ANTICIPATED IMPACTS The proposed dredging would result in impacts to up to 21.3 acres of submerged shallow bottom. According to the application, approximately 44,830 cubic yards would be excavated within the intertidal area. The project would result in the fill of approximately 40.4 acres of upper beach (above NHW) and would fill approximately 74.4 acres of intertidal area and near -shore shallow bottom. The dredging and beach fill would result in temporary increases in turbidity. Exact final figures will be dependent on future conditions and may vary slightly due to minor adjustments based on site conditions at time of construction. Temporary impacts to benthic and invertebrate infaunal communities can be expected. The applicant is proposing to limit work between October 1 through March 30, in accordance with the currently permitted timing restriction between April 1 and September 30. The applicant states the project State of North Carolina I Environmental Quality I Coastal Management Wilmington Office 1 127 Cardinal Drive Extension I Wilmington, North Carolina 28405 910 796 7215 Figure 8 Beach HOA -Major Modification No. 139-04 Page 4 would be constructed in accordance with the Terms and Conditions of the State Programmatic Biological Opinion (SPBO) and South Atlantic Regional Biological Opinion (SARBO) A staging area and access to the beach for heavy equipment has been identified at an existing public access corridor at the southern end of the project (See Sheet 10 of 15). According to the applicant, an existing emergency vehicle access at the north end may also be used for heavy equipment access to the beach. Jamie Pratt , Applica .Name Appl nt Signature CAMA Permit Application Project Narrative Figure 8 Island Banks Channel Dredging Proposed Channel Widening Project Narrative Location The project site is located on the southern half of Figure 8 Island in New Hanover County, North Carolina. Figure 8 Island is a privately owned, residential barrier island located in southeastern North Carolina along the beaches of Onslow Bay. The Island is bounded to the south by Mason Inlet, to the west by Banks Channel and the Atlantic Intracoastal Waterway, and to the north by Rich Inlet. Figure 8 Island is accessible from US 17 via Porters Neck Road to Edgewater Club Road to Bridge Road. Figure 8 Island is not open to the public and there is a gatehouse at the bridge crossing the AIWW. Access needs to be arranged prior to arrival with the HOA by calling 910-686-0635. The approximate geographic coordinates of Figure 8 Island are Latitude 34° 15' 13" N and longitude 77045' 33" W. The Island consists of primarily residential single family home properties with a clubhouse and administrative building on Bridge Road. Properties along Banks Channel, on the west side of the Island, are bulkheaded and nearly every home has a boat dock. The oceanfront beach maintains a vegetated dune system consisting of typical beach vegetation including American Beach Grass and Sea Oats. Background Figure 8 Island has maintained its bordering channels and beach nourishment projects with localized dredging projects that beneficially use beach quality sand to replenish its oceanfront shoreline. These projects include a coordinated effort with New Hanover County and the Mason Inlet Preservation Group to periodically dredge Mason Creek and Inlet (NC DEQ Permit #151-01) as well as a private project to dredge Banks Channel running along the west side of the Island (NCDEQ Permit #139-04). Other work is completed on the north end of the island via dredging of Nixon Channel (NCDEQ Permit #6-01) with beneficial placement north of Bridge Road. Beach quality sand from Mason Creek, Mason Inlet, and Banks Channel have been used to nourish the southern 10,000 linear feet of the island (Bridge Road south), constructing a sacrificial primary dune system and replenishing the dry sand beach. The abovementioned projects have successfully protected Figure 8 Island's property owners from major hurricane damage despite several brushes and a direct land falling hurricane in recent years. Navigation around the island has been adequate, despite a few hazard areas in Banks Channel, which this request for a permit modification seeks to address. Banks Channel (NCDEQ #139-04) was originally permitted for dredging in 2004 as a 125' wide and 7+2' MLW deep channel that followed the outline of the sound side docks. In 2006, and major modification was approved for this permit application to widen approximately 72% of the channel from 125' to 200'. The widening of the channel from the "T" Canal north allowed for safer boat navigation in the narrow waters adjacent to homeowners docks. Because the widening modification was requested at the same time as the Mason Inlet Relocation Project, it was requested at the time that a portion of Banks Channel remain at the 125' width. This would allow observation of how Mason Inlet behaved following the relocation project without altering the adjacent channel system. The southern 2,500 feet of Banks Channel remained at the original width while the rest of the channel was permitted to 200' wide. A turning basin was allowed at the very southern terminus of Banks Channel to allow boats and water skiers to make a U-turn and head in the other direction. Multiple other projects have also been permitted and completed prior to the current permit #139-04. Historical work was completed in Banks Channel under NCDEQ Permits #11-85, 26-92, and 29-98 and all had a bottom channel width between 125 and 200 feet and authorized depths of -6' to -9' MLW. Additionally, the USACE held a permit (5-69) from 1969 that authorized a 180' wide channel and a dredge depth of -18' MLW. With a standard 3H:1V side slope, this constructed channel would be 234' wide at elevation -9 MLW, which is the permitted depth of the channel under 139-04. The channel modification proposed under this permit application falls under areas that have been previously dredged and is not new dredge work. Project Purpose Over the past few years, as the population of southeastern North Carolina has exploded and as more people are enjoying our waterways via boats, the low tide shoals at the south end of Figure 8 has become an extremely popular destination. A typical summer weekend day features a solid perimeter of boats along the back barrier shoal of Figure 8 Island as well as the sand bars that become exposed along the borders of Banks Channel. In wide open waters such as Mason Inlet and Creek, there is sufficient room for safe navigation around the boaters, however in the constricted area of Banks Channel at the southern end of Figure 8 Island, the anchor lines and recreational boaters infringe on the navigation channel and safe passage between the beachgoers and homeowners docks has become a hazardous activity. With boats anchored off of the sandbar by bow and stern anchors, the navigable water becomes very tight and welcomes a boating accident. The purpose of this project is to alleviate the navigation hazard that exists at the southern end of Banks Channel and allow safe passage of boats past homeowner's docks during the summer months while minimally impacting the adjacent habitat and recreational beaches. Additionally, due to the growth of the sandbars within Banks Channel, the deep water channel has been squeezed against homeowners' bulkheads resulting in scour and undercutting of the installed sheet piles and failure of the structures for multiple homeowners. A recent survey of the area indicates water depths of 18-20 feet deep (NAVD88 datum) against the bulkhead. This scour will continue or worsen with the continued accretion along the sandbars and will threaten the stability of the home itself. A wider channel within this area alleviates the hydraulic pressure on the existing bulkhead and reduces the likelihood of failure. Project Description To remedy these situations, we are seeking to modify the current permit to allow the entire channel length to be dredged to a width of 200'. This modification is seeking to widen the remaining 2,370 feet of channel from the currently permitted 125' to the 200' width of the rest of Banks Channel. Dredge depths are proposed to remain as currently permitted, -9.0' Mean Low Water. Beach quality sand from within the channel would be placed on the southern 10,000 feet of oceanfront shoreline of Figure 8 Island. The dredged material will be used to repair dune scarps and beach erosion caused by Hurricanes Matthew, Florence and the remnants of Michael. All proposed beachfill templates are within the footprint of previous construction projects and the overall project will remain under the 50 cubic yards/linear foot of fill guidelines. Currently, approximately 193,300 cubic yards of sand exist within the full Banks Channel template with roughly 100,000 cubic yards in the proposed modification area between stations 3+00 and 27+00. Historically, this channel dredging has been done on the same interval as the Mason Creek/Mason Inlet maintenance dredging (Permit #151-01) to save in mobilization costs of dredge equipment. It is feasible that this trend will continue and the combined fill from these channels will be utilized to complete the full nourishment of the Figure 8 Island oceanfront. This permit application contains a set of permit/construction plan which show the full proposed channel layout and beachfill design. Dune Planting Following the completion of the project, a contractor will be hired to plant vegetation in the dunes in order to provide stabilization and encourage further dune growth. A small tractor will be used to bore holes and place the plants, and a water truck will be used to water the planted dunes. Dune plantings will occur on the southern 10,000 linear feet of oceanfront dune system of Figure 8 Island within the spatial parameters of this proposed project. The total area of dune plantings will be dependent upon the final dune construction — where the dune is repaired or rebuilt on the beach and the existing vegetation on site, however, the total potential square footage of plantings is approximately 649,000 square feet or 14.9 acres. Dune plantings following beach and dune construction will most likely consist of Sea Oats (Uniola paniculata), transplanted from a greenhouse, and planted as sprigs in late spring/early summer just before they come out of dormancy. The timing of the initial planting is critical to ensure the Sea Oats have a chance to survive and thrive. Final planting times and duration depend upon the dredging project and weather, but a work time from of 2-4 weeks in May or June can be used for planning purposes. Environmental Impacts Care was taken with the design of the proposed modifications to minimize overall impacts to the environment and surrounding habitats. While this area is extremely popular for anthropogenic activities, it is also tremendously important habitat to a lot of wildlife including shorebirds, fishes, and turtles. The channel alignment avoids all designated Primary Nursery Areas (PNA) and the applicant is not seeking to adjust the current environmental moratoriums that are attached to NCDEQ Permit 139-04. All work under this modification will be within the Terms and Conditions of the NC State Wide Programmatic Biological Opinion and the South Atlantic Regional BO. The wetland line was surveyed via topographic points and plotted against the proposed channel alignment and there will be no wetland impacts associated with the project. The daylight line representing were the dredge template side slope intersects the existing grade is shown on sheet 3 in the project plans. While these lines are about 10 feet apart at station 7+04 in Banks Channel, additional sloughing of the shoreline is not expected as a natural 3HAV slope is included in the design parameters. The beach disposal area footprint is not modified for this project from all previous work completed on Figure 8 Island under the existing Banks Channel Permit (#139-04) and New Hanover County's Mason Inlet permit (#151-01). This modification request does not expand the overall impacts to the oceanfront beach beyond what has historically been constructed in the dune or nearshore. An inlet hazard area, shown on the map, exists on the south end of Figure 8 Island. Under existing rules, no new dune construction is allowed within an Inlet Hazard Area. All dune construction proposed under this permit application falls within what has previously been constructed and works to restore the eroded dune to the pre Hurricane Florence condition. All excavation within Banks Channel is either inter or sub -tidal (falling below the Mean High Water contour). The total area of inter/sub-tidal area to be impacted is 928,448 square feet in Banks Channel (21.3 acres). Geotechnical Analysis In accordance with the North Carolina Sediment Criteria Rules (NC CAMA 15A NCAC 07H.0312), vibracores were collected from the channel widening area to determine the quality of sediment within the proposed template and ensure that all sand disposed of on the beach was similar to the native sand. Athena Technologies was contracted to collect 6 cores in the vicinity of the proposed project area and began and completed field collection work on July 11, 2018. The cores were taken to Athena's laboratory to be split and were returned to TI Coastal on July 13, 2018. In TI Coastal's geotechnical lab, the split vibracores were described, photographed, and sampled for grain size and calcium carbonate analysis. Samples were collected to represent separate stratigraphic layers within the cores. If a single layer was over 3 feet thick, multiple samples were taken to verify the visual uniformity within the strata. Individual samples were dried and sieved to determine grain size distribution and define the granularmetric parameters of the sediment. Calcium Carbonate analysis, via acid digestion, was performed for each sample as well to determine overall shell content. The vibracore locations were used to create a "spider map" which breaks Banks Channel into polygons where one vibracore represents the sediment within that segment of channel. The polygons were delineated by the midpoint of the straight line distance between two adjacent cores. Volume analysis was performed within the channel footprint for each core compartment to determine the amount of sediment each core layer represented. Once the total volume of sediment for the individual core layer was calculated, a weighted average of the sieve analysis was created, multiplying the total volume by the percent of sediment retained on each sieve. Compiling these numbers, an overall composite sample was created for Banks Channel within the expanded footprint area. It should be noted that while a vibracore was collected at location #1, this core was not used in statistical analysis as it did not fall within the template boundaries—only cores 2 through 6 were used for the grain size analysis. As expected and consistent with previous dredging projects in Banks Channel, the sand within the expanded channel area is of very high quality and a good match to the sand that is currently on Figure 8 Island. There are no existing native grain size statistics for Figure 8 due to the history of nourishment projects, however the vibracores collected show high quality, beach compatible quartz sand within template. Average grain size was 0.18 mm with 1.2% calcium carbonate and 0.2% fines (passing the 230 sieve). The weighted average statistics indicate that the material is 0.0% Cobbles, 0.0% Gravel, 0.1% Granular, 99.8% Sand, and 0.1% Silt. Average calcium carbonate for the expanded channel area is 1.3%. A table with the weighted average grain size statistics as well as the individual core photos, descriptions, sample grain size distribution and sample granularmentric tables are included following this narrative. Unsuitable Material Handling While the quality of sand within the channel has always been high quality for previous projects and the vibracores collected from the expansion area is also beach compatible, a plan is in place to handle large amounts of unsuitable material. If by chance the dredge encounters unsuitable material within the channel, operations will cease and the dredge will relocate to another area. Significant amounts of unsuitable material on the beach will be removed and placed within DA -241, located at the intersection of Mason Creek and the AIWW, outside of the USACE Right of Way. Because any potential unsuitable material would be placed outside of the USACE ROW, it is not subject to the new guidelines which severely limit the use of any USACE disposal area for outside dredge material placement.
